webstaff: add support for editing authority records
authorGalen Charlton <gmc@esilibrary.com>
Fri, 28 Aug 2015 00:45:23 +0000 (00:45 +0000)
committerGalen Charlton <gmc@esilibrary.com>
Fri, 28 Aug 2015 00:45:23 +0000 (00:45 +0000)
commit3b5b49644765877d6fe3232b65183f31868d42bc
tree684888fe80e5ed0e4ff54183c632465bee862e50
parentcc8944a9a86d18789cc40256780ad5a0781f28c8
webstaff: add support for editing authority records

This adds basic support for invoking the MARC editor on
authority records, and fixes a couple bugs discovered
along the way. The route currently supported is

/cat/catalog/authority/:authority_id/marc_edit

In the future, some sort of summary view of an authority
record might be added, in which case the route
"/cat/catalog/authority/:authority_id" is available.

Signed-off-by: Galen Charlton <gmc@esilibrary.com>
Open-ILS/src/templates/staff/cat/catalog/t_authority.tt2 [new file with mode: 0644]
Open-ILS/src/templates/staff/cat/share/t_marcedit.tt2
Open-ILS/web/js/ui/default/staff/cat/catalog/app.js
Open-ILS/web/js/ui/default/staff/cat/services/marcedit.js
Open-ILS/web/js/ui/default/staff/cat/services/tagtable.js